Output 7c8b1db66191d129d42ab161c7f72e4c653619f542dc74f9e5456c26128189d6:1

value
68323435
script pubkey
OP_0 OP_PUSHBYTES_20 f6b7ad25abab61015381ff84bc2c406bfa8fb495
address
ltc1q76m66fdt4dssz5upl7ztctzqd0agldy439j454
transaction
7c8b1db66191d129d42ab161c7f72e4c653619f542dc74f9e5456c26128189d6
spent
true